A method to improve the computation of tidal potential in the equilibrium configuration of a close binary system

, &
Pages 1831-1840 | Received 09 Sep 2008, Published online: 18 Nov 2010
 

Abstract

A classical problem in celestial mechanics is the study of equilibrium configuration figures of extended deformable bodies. A particularly interesting case of this problem is the study of the figures of equilibrium of close binary systems. In this paper an improved theory of tidal potential using Clairaut coordinates has been developed by two methods, one based in analytical developments and one iterative.
